Original text on this topic:
Rhinos are large vegetable-feeding mammals, with in proportion to their size a relatively low potential longevity and viability.
No. Average in months Maximum
all species 10 110 342
R.bicornis 1 271 271
R.lasiotis 3 132 342
R. sondaicus 1 130 130
R.sumatrensis 4 7.5 17
R.unicornis 1 281 281
